Pros

Salary; There is much to learn that you can either use at Honda or at another company to bring real value to their organization.

Cons

These are some of the characteristics of the Financial area I work in: Poor management communication. Superiors don't make what they want very clear, changing their minds all the time. This leads to the second problem: if something happens because you did something your superiors told you to do, they will throw you under the bus to save them even though its not your fault. Feedback system is in negative format - "this is why this didn't work", leading to bad moral,. They emphasize being on "one team", but actually they strongly encourage unhealthy competition and no co-op; Poor job/career mapping. No one knows how to advance, outside of "do very well" for your performance review, but they give you vague goals and no direction or guidance; You do not feel like you are a vested interest within the company. Also, there are no true interest in technical employee advancement, so they will not pay for you to go back to school, with no plans on ever doing so; Mandatory overtime (if you don't like working overtime).

Pros

One of the cheapest states to live in. Start at around 55k a year which is like making 75k in an expensive city. Plenty of opportunity for overtime. May not be doing what you went to school for but it's a great introduction to the automotive industry and makes you money while you gain experience

Cons

If you are not a high motor person you won't like it. You won't be hanging out a computer all day.
